
When Tracey was a kid, she filled notebooks with stories about kind dragons and talking dolphins before she exchanged her pen for a career creating impact in social and environmental movements across Australia. But writing clung to her like a secret begging to be spilled and, and by the end of her twenties, the pull was impossible to resist. Now, she’s in the final year of her BA in Creative Writing and has graduated from the Australian Writers’ Centre’s ‘Write Your Novel’ program. Her short stories have been recognised with Honorable Mentions in Elegant Literature competitions, and one was long-listed for the inaugural Mind Shine Bright award.
Tracey writes character driven speculative fiction, sometimes drawing on her own life experiences to explore queerness, identity, family and grief in her work—always with a healthy sprinkle (or more) of magic, sass and adventure.
